I <br />JUN 3 ' 99 <br />Wal- Azv4 <br />AJorrdJ. <br />BOOK 6, F'1uE 1- 7 <br />Chairman Eggert commented that she still feels that the curve <br />coming off of U.S-#1 onto Indian River Boulevard is the worse we <br />have in the whole of the place. <br />Public Works Director Jim Davis presented staff's <br />recommendation for denial of this request and recommended that the <br />property owners association enter into a single streetlight <br />agreement program. He advised that the average cost is $180 a year <br />per streetlight. <br />Commissioner Wheeler was interested to see if the property <br />owners' association would be willing to fund it, but wanted to see <br />the light installed in any event. In fact, he didn't feel we had <br />enough streetlights on the Boulevard. It is difficult at night, <br />particularly if it is raining, and streetlights go a long way in <br />preventing accidents. The streetlight is needed, but the question <br />is who is to pay for it. <br />Commissioner Scurlock agreed that the big question is who will <br />pay for it.
